Still in the Zweite Bundesliga, Schalke 04 remain one of the giants of German football. Not just in Germany, but worldwide. Seriously. By membership numbers, they’re the sixth-largest football club on the planet.


They come from a city with a unique history. Gelsenkirchen experienced a rise and fall unlike anywhere else in Germany. Once home to more than 400,000 people — with booming industry and steady jobs — it’s now one of the poorest cities in the country, with a population of 260,000.


Through all the hardship, one thing has stayed constant: the football club that plays its home matches in a spaceship — the Veltins-Arena.


Schalke’s story is one of triumph, collapse, and an unbreakable commitment to staying true to your club.
